titleOfInvention Melamine resin molding composition and molded article
abstract P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: In recent years, especially in a system for supplying warm food by reheating treatment in a hospital, a so-called reheating cart system, melamine-based resin molding materials have a problem of discoloration of tableware due to repeated high-temperature rapid heating. There is a demand for heat-resistant melamine resin molding materials. SOLUTION: A non-wood fiber having a color difference (ΔE) of 5 or less in a heat resistance test at 130 ° C. × 24 hours is blended in an amount of 10 to 50 parts by weight with respect to 100 parts by weight of the melamine resin. The composition and a pulp having a color difference (ΔE) of 5 or less in a heat resistance test at 130 ° C. × 24 hours and a pulp having a color difference (ΔE) in a heat resistance test of 130 ° C. × 24 hours of 6 to 12 The composition for melamine resin molding which mix | blended the mixture with 10-50 weight part with respect to 100 weight part of melamine resin.
